Enclosure 1 in No. 6.
Mr. J. J. Symonds, P.M., to His Honor the Superintendent of the Southern Division.
Sir,—
I have the honor to report to you my arrival here this day from Otago, where I proceeded to superintend and assist the New Zealand Company's Agent in effecting the purchase of land from the aborigines, for the site of the settlement of New Edinburgh.
The marked discourtesy and want of co-operation of Mr. Tuckett, the New Zealand Company's Agent, compelled me to resort to this measure, which I adopted after mature deliberation, considering it impracticable to carry into effect the commands of His Excellency the Governor, which the accompanying correspondence will, I trust, suffice to substantiate.
I have, &c.,
John Jermyn Symonds, P.M.
